England get the better of Nigeria on penalties

England faced off against Nigeria at Lang Park in Brisbane. The Three Lionesses struggled to break down a stubborn Nigeria on penalty kicks. The game had to go to penalty kicks which England eventually won. England who are the favorites continue their pursuit to winning the World Cup. This game also saw star player Lauren James pick up a red card. Futbol Mundial brings you the best moments from the game between The Three Lionesses and Nigeria. 

Just was not to be for a resilient Nigeria team

It was absolute heartbreak for Nigeria against England in the penalty shootout. As a matter of fact keeper Nnadozie was so heartbroken that she was reduced to tears at the end of the match. The Super Eagles had given it everything until the final whistle. Nigeria were close to taking the lead in the 16th minute as Ashleigh Plumptree had struck the post. Kanu had then struck the post once again as Nigeria were searching for their big moment however it just was not to be. Despite losing to England Nigeria will keep their heads high and hope to return stronger next time around.

England to miss James in the last eight

Despite not managing to score over 120 minutes England managed to get past Nigeria on penalty kicks. England were threatened by Nigeria on multiple occasions but managed to hold their nerve to reach the quarterfinals. They even had a chance to take the lead in the 75th minute but Daly’s header was saved by Nnadozie. England will now go on to face either Colombia or Jamaica who have been very impressive in the tournament. This will be a much sterner test as both these teams have been more impressive than Nigeria. They will also be missing Lauren James who was sent off for stomping on Alozie.
